What is one reason matter is able to move around within the earth

One of the reason that matter is able to move around within the earth is THE INTERACTION BETWEEN MATTER AND ENERGY.
The major source of energy on the earth is the sun. The heat energy from the sun is used to drive many chemical reactions on the earth. When the heat energy of the sun heat up a matter, it increases its temperature and causes the particles in the matter to move with greater motion until phase change occur. For instance, when the sun heat up water in the ocean, the particles of the water move about with great energy until they escape into the atmosphere in form of vapour.

Robert E. Lee was is a controversial character in history.

Explanation:

Robert E. Lee led the fighting forces in favor of the American Confederate States, a self-proclaimed nation of 11 slave states, during the Civil War between 1862 and 1865. The general was known for his aggressive battle tactics, which left huge numbers of dead during the conflict.

The military is also remembered today as a symbol of racism and the American slave past. Historical documents trace Lee's cruelty to his own slaves, inherited by him after the death of his father-in-law, George Washington Parke Custis, one of the greatest slave owners of the time and grandson of the first US president, George Washington.

After the Civil War, the military man even regretted and wrote some letters arguing that slavery was "a political and moral evil." He also intervened in favor of the union of the American states and defended that the nation should progress against the ideals supported during the conflict that ended in 1865.

Still, it is common, especially in the southern United States, to find schools, avenues, and statues in honor of the general, considered by some to be a Civil War hero.
